Default 2014 Cherokee Transmission Problem

I have a 2014 Cherokee Trailhawk that been at the dealer for 2 weeks now with the constant problem of stalling, service transmission light on then instructing me to shut and restart and select a gear. After restart the transmission would then start to make a loud banging noise and the Drive indicator light would blink and instruct me to shut vehicle off at this point all indicator light would come on. It has been at the dealer for 2 weeks now and I can not get a straight answer out of the service manager Carla as well as the representative from Jeep who keep telling me their transmission tech has to look at it and there are numerous vehicles there with the same problem and they will get to it. The 948TE trannys delayed the on-sale date of the 14+ Cherokee KL's, and they're still not perfect... you could get a PCM reflash done at your dealer to remedy it, but not sure whether it'd be a permanent fix (probably not).
